The latest update on the NVQ 4 Health and Social Care Standards modules has sent shockwaves through the industry, with significant changes and improvements being implemented to enhance the quality of care provided to individuals in need. Let's take a closer look at the key highlights of this groundbreaking development:
| Module | Changes |
|---|---|
| Module 1: Communication in Health and Social Care Settings | Updated guidelines on effective communication strategies, including the use of technology and non-verbal cues. |
| Module 2: Promoting Health and Wellbeing | New emphasis on holistic approaches to health promotion, focusing on mental health and well-being. |
| Module 3: Safeguarding and Protecting Individuals from Harm and Abuse | Enhanced training on recognizing and reporting signs of abuse, with a stronger emphasis on safeguarding vulnerable populations. |
